Chhattisgarh: Victim of Jammu bus stand blast seeks govt help

Victim of the Jammu bus stand blast, Suklal Singh Siddar, a resident of Janjgir–Champa district of Chhattisgarh, has sought financial aid from the government for his treatment and providing his family two square meal.

Janjgir-Champa: The grenade blast that took place at Jammu bus stand has left many seriously injured. One amongst them is Suklal Singh Siddar, a resident of Manjarkud area of Janjgir–Champa district of Chhattisgarh. His condition has become such that he is now seeking help from the government.

After the attack, Sukalal was taken to a hospital in Jammu for treatment where he was provided financial aid of ₹20,000 by the government out of which he spent ₹15,000 for the treatment.

Sukalal is a labourer by profession who had gone to J&K to earn a livelihood, but little did he know that he would end up falling victim to a terror attack. He recalls that the sound of the blast was such that he fell unconscious.

Now, his condition is such that his one arm and leg are severely injured. Sukalal returned home in Chattisgarh after the attack, but till now he has not shown any major sign of improvement nor did any prominent personality visited him.

He has his mother, wife, four sons and a daughter in the family. Now, he wonders how he would work and earn two square meal for his family. Lying on the bed, he said, "I don't even have money for the treatment. I, hence, seek the government's help."

He now hopes that any government representative or organisation would come up for his help.

The grenade attack took place at the crowded bus stand in Jammu on March 7 killing three people and leaving nearly 40 injured.
